Our take: Makan Singapura in Sengkang appears to be a food court with highly inconsistent offerings and significant operational issues.
While some stalls like AshesX (for burgers) and Bob Mie (for sambal Geprek) might offer decent food, the overall experience is marred by poor hygiene, uncomfortable dining conditions, and questionable billing practices.
We note recurring complaints about dirty, oily floors, stuffy environments due to lack of air-conditioning, and uncleared tables.
The Mookata stall, 555 Mookata, has been criticised for rigid and unaccommodating policies regarding dining time, even when the establishment is not busy.
Furthermore, there are serious allegations of dishonest billing, such as a 'TIP/OVER PAY' charge of $0.05 on a PayLah transaction, which we find concerning.
We also observe that food quality varies wildly between vendors, with Yassin Kampung specifically called out for 'appalling' and 'inedible' black pepper beef served cold after a long wait.
While the $5.50 Maggi Goreng was mentioned, its value is debatable given the additional $3 for what turned out to be chopped, mixed-in chicken rather than a proper fried piece.
The $3.20 Iced Milo and $1.80 Hot Teh also seem to reflect a higher price point for drinks.
Given the numerous negative experiences, we advise caution.
This is a place to avoid unless you are specifically targeting a known decent stall during off-peak hours and are prepared for potential operational shortcomings.

Makan Singapura - Sengkang receives predominantly negative feedback, with recurring issues around poor hygiene, uncomfortable dining environments, and inconsistent food quality across its various stalls.
While some individual stalls like AshesX and Bob Mie offer decent options, experiences at others, particularly Yassin Kampung and 555 Mookata, are often highly disappointing due to tough, cold, or unappetizing food, and rigid or dishonest service practices.
Customers frequently cite issues with ventilation, dirty floors, and questionable billing.
